Gabon's election: A fresh start?
chevron_right
Joseph Sigal, an expert in Gabonese politics, discusses the significance of Gabon's upcoming presidential elections following a military coup. He raises concerns about the legitimacy of elections under military oversight. Umaru Fufana, a Sierra Leonean journalist, reveals troubling connections between the president and drug trafficking, including a recent embassy scandal. Danielle Resnick sheds light on the new Sahel States passport, addressing its implications for trade and regional dynamics. This lively conversation tackles critical political and social issues shaping West Africa.
